多种MVC框架集成开发的研究与应用的开题报告.docx
上传人:快乐****蜜蜂 上传时间:2024-09-14 格式:DOCX 页数:3 大小:11KB 金币:5 举报 版权申诉
预览加载中,请您耐心等待几秒...

多种MVC框架集成开发的研究与应用的开题报告.docx

多种MVC框架集成开发的研究与应用的开题报告.docx

预览

在线预览结束,喜欢就下载吧,查找使用更方便

5 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

多种MVC框架集成开发的研究与应用的开题报告一、选题背景随着互联网技术的不断发展,前端页面日趋复杂,后端业务逻辑也越来越庞大。在这样的背景下,为了简化业务逻辑的开发,提高开发效率,MVC(模型-视图-控制器)框架应运而生。MVC框架将应用程序分为三个组成部分:模型(Model)、视图(View)、控制器(Controller),三者之间的职责非常清晰,可以让开发人员更加集中地关注自己应该关注的部分。目前市面上有很多MVC框架,如SpringMVC、Struts2、Yii等。虽然每个框架都有自己的特点和优势,但由于各有不同的设计理念和开发方式,不同框架之间的集成开发存在一定的挑战。因此,本文拟对多种MVC框架集成开发进行研究与应用。二、研究内容本文主要包括以下三个方面的研究内容:1.多种MVC框架的概述与分析本部分将对多种MVC框架进行概述与分析,包括框架的设计理念、使用场景、优缺点等方面的介绍。具体框架包括SpringMVC、Struts2、Yii等。2.多种MVC框架的集成开发本部分将对多种MVC框架进行集成开发的探讨,包括框架之间的整合方案、组件的选择与使用、跨框架的调用等方面的研究。3.多种MVC框架的应用实践本部分将根据具体的应用场景,选择其中几种MVC框架进行实践。具体包括基于SpringMVC的企业开发项目、基于Struts2的中小型网站、基于Yii的社交网络等应用实践。三、研究意义本文的研究可以帮助开发人员更好地了解多种MVC框架,梳理各框架之间的联系和区别,为开发人员选择最适合的框架提供参考。同时,通过多种MVC框架的集成开发和应用实践,可以提高开发人员的技能水平和开发效率,为企业部署开发提供更优质的解决方案。四、研究方法本文的研究方法主要包括文献综述和实践应用两个方面。在文献综述方面,将对相关的文献进行收集、整理和归纳。在实践应用方面,将根据具体应用场景,选择相应的MVC框架进行实践,收集实验数据并进行分析。五、进度安排本文的进度安排如下:1.完成选题和论文提纲的制定(1周);2.收集相关文献并进行文献综述(3周);3.对多种MVC框架进行概述与分析(2周);4.对多种MVC框架进行集成开发的探讨(2周);5.选择相应的MVC框架进行应用实践并进行数据收集与分析(4周);6.论文的初步撰写和修改(2周);7.论文的终稿撰写和定稿(2周)。六、预期成果本文的预期成果包括:1.对多种MVC框架的概述与分析;2.对多种MVC框架集成开发的探讨;3.多种MVC框架的应用实践总结;4.相关数据的分析和展示;5.论文撰写和提交。七、参考文献1.李炳南、张珂.MVC框架的分析与比较[J].科技视界,2019(1):94-95.2.邓亦然.Struts2开发指南[M].电子工业出版社,2018.3.蔡宜勤、张跃楠.基于Yii的社交网络开发与设计[J].计算机时代,2020(2):98-99.